A Timeline of the Star Wars Movies: From 1977 to Now
The Star Wars franchise began in 1977 with the release of the original movie, “Star Wars Episode IV: A New Hope”. This was followed by two sequels, “The Empire Strikes Back” in 1980 and “Return of the Jedi” in 1983. These three films together make up the original trilogy.
In 1999, the franchise was revived with the release of “Star Wars Episode I: The Phantom Menace”, which was followed by two more prequel films, “Attack of the Clones” in 2002 and “Revenge of the Sith” in 2005. These three films constitute the prequel trilogy.
In 2015, the franchise was rebooted with the release of “Star Wars Episode VII: The Force Awakens”. This was followed by two more sequels, “The Last Jedi” in 2017 and “The Rise of Skywalker” in 2019. These three films make up the sequel trilogy.

The TV Shows
There have been several Star Wars TV shows over the years, including “Star Wars: The Clone Wars” (2008-2020), “Star Wars Rebels” (2014-2018), “Star Wars Resistance” (2018-2020) and “The Mandalorian” (2019-present). There are also plans for more TV shows in the future.
